One such chemical is butylated hydroxyanisole (BHA), a synthetic antioxidant used to extend shelf life by preventing fats and oils from going rancid. Common uses of BHA in foods
BHA is added to fats, oils and processed foods to prevent rancidity – the chemical breakdown that makes fats smell and taste bad. It is commonly found in:
- Processed meats (sausages, hot dogs, deli meats)
- Chips, crackers and fried snacks
- Cereals and granola bars
- Chewing gum and candy
- Frozen dinners and instant meals
- Vegetable oils and shortening
- Baked goods (especially those with added fats)
